Jason Segel broke out in feature films by having top-billing in "Forgetting Sarah Marshall," which he starred in and wrote, and for his role in the film "Knocked Up." Segel's other feature film credits include "Tenacious D in the Pick of Destiny," "Slackers," "Can't Hardly Wait," "Dead Man on Campus," "I Love You, Man" and "Bad Teacher." This year he wrote and starred in the much anticipated film "The Greatest Muppet Movie Ever Made," which has garnered great success at the box office. Additionally, he will star in the movie "Jeff Who Lives at Home," expected to be released this year, and is currently in pre-production on "The Adventurer’s Handbook."
His television credits include the role of Nick Andopolis in the series "Freaks and Geeks" and a recurring role on "Undeclared."
Additionally, Segel’s voice can be heard in the animated movie "Despicable Me."
He was born and raised in Los Angeles, where he lives. His birth date is Jan. 18.
